Job description

The City of New Albany Indiana is seeking an energetic applicant who enjoy serving the general public and delivering quality recreational programs. This seasonal part-time position is responsible for coordinating quality recreational and leisure programs and activities as well as special events and assisting in providing services to the community.

DUTIES

Specific Duties and Responsibilities:

  1. Assist in the planning, implementation and evaluation of overall parks and recreation programs, including but not limited to: practice and concessions, camps, sports leagues, enrichment field trips, and special events.
  2. Address public questions and concerns regarding recreation program offerings and related issues.
  3. Promote collaborative efforts with community organizations.
  4. Instruct and lead recreation programs and activities as required.
  5. Maintain a safe recreational environment for participants.
  6. Coordinate use of program area facilities in accordance with facility use agreements and/or regulations; file necessary permits, forms, registers public and schedule reservations as needed.
  7. Assists in taking calls and tactfully answers requests; screens calls and answers questions,' routes questions and complaints as required; provides general information.
  8. Attends City and industry-related meetings, as required.
  9. Functions as a contributing member of the department's team and other teams, as assigned.
  10. Performs other du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S

Standards of Performance:

  1. Excellent organizational skills.
  2. Ability to professionally and efficiently correspond with external and internal clients and vendors via phone, email, and written correspondence.
  3. Excellent attention to detail in an environment with rapidly changing data.
  4. Interpersonal relationships which encourage openness, candor and trust, both internally and outside of the Company.
  5. Accurate and timely completion of projects and/or reports.
  6. Maintenance of City information in a confidential manner.
  7. Considerable knowledge of the principles, theories and techniques of recreation programs in assigned program area.
  8. Ability to use independent judgment and take initiative.

Mental and Physical Requirements:

  1. Ability to sit, stand, or walk for long periods of time.
  2. Ability to lift up to 50 pounds.

Working Environment and Conditions:

  1. This position involves working within an indoor office environment around general office equipment, including computers and work stations, as well as outdoor venues such as ballparks.
  2. This position may will require working non-traditional hours including predominantly evenings and weekend and doing so in inclement weather.

Education, Experience and Training

  1. High school graduation or equivalency, 2-year college degree preferred and/or 2 years of recreation experience.
  2. Skilled in the use of computers, including word processing and social media marketing.
  3. Must have valid Indiana Driver's License.
  4. Current certification in CPR/AED/First Aid, preferred.

Equipment and Tools:

  1. Computer and peripherals.
  2. Recreational equipment.
